What is Misted Double Glazing?
Misted double glazing takes place when moisture gets trapped between the panes of double-glazed glass. This results in a foggy or misty appearance, thus jeopardizing the aesthetic appeal and energy efficiency of windows. While it is mainly a cosmetic issue, misting can suggest underlying issues with the seals of the double-glazed units, which might require repairs or replacement.
Reasons For Misted Double Glazing
Several elements can add to the misting of double-glazed windows. Comprehending these causes can help homeowners take preventive procedures and act swiftly when issues emerge. Here's a list of common causes:
- Seal Failure:
- Over time, the seals that hold the gas in between the panes can deteriorate due to age, temperature changes, or physical tension.
- Temperature Fluctuations:
- Rapid temperature level modifications can trigger the seals to broaden and contract, leading to eventual failure.
- Poor Installation:
- Inadequate installation practices can cause lasting issues such as improperly sealed windows.
- Use and Tear:
- As windows age, wear and tear can lead to fractures or spaces that allow moisture to go into.
- Production Defects:
- Occasionally, defective products or producing procedures can result in premature misting.

Cost of Misted Double Glazing Repairs in the UK
The cost of repairing misted double glazing can differ extensively based upon numerous factors, consisting of the measurements of the windows, the degree of the damage, and whether the existing units require replacing or just sealing.
- Misted Unit Replacement: Costs can range from ₤ 250 to ₤ 800 or more per window.
- Seal Replacement: The expense can generally lie between ₤ 100 and ₤ 300.
- Dehumidification Services: These may cost between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150, depending on the provider.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How long does double glazing last?
Double glazing generally lasts anywhere in between 20 to 30 years, but this lifespan can be impacted by ecological elements and the quality of setup.
2. Can I prevent misting in my double-glazed windows?
Routine maintenance checks and ensuring proper installation can assist minimize the danger of misting. Consider addressing any visible cracks or use immediately.
3. Is it worth repairing misted double glazing?
In numerous cases, it is worth repairing instead of replacing, particularly if the frames are in excellent condition. Replacement must be thought about if the insulation worth is compromised.
4. How can I tell if my double glazing has lost its seal?
Noticeable condensation between glass panes is a strong indicator that the seal has actually failed.
